Correct they will get you , eventually. I bought two new ones out of Gulfport a few years ago. Didn't have to pay taxes there. So my wife and I thought hell yea we got over on LA and saved some major $$$ by not paying the taxes. Well sometime between a year to two years later we got hammered threatening that if we did not pay we would get fined big-time and have all kinds of penalties to pay. Thought for sure all the paper work got lost but it found its way to us via Jackson MS. We were able to get out of the penalties and such and ended up just paying the original taxes though. Plus we never registered them in LA and they still found us.
